Houston (IAH) to Mitchell (MHE) Flight Distance

The flight distance from George Bush Intcntl/Houston Airport (IAH) in Houston, United States to Mitchell Municipal Airport (MHE) in Mitchell, United States is 1,552 kilometers (964 miles / 838 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 3h, flying north at a heading of 352°.

This is a medium-haul route that may be operated by either narrow-body or wide-body aircraft depending on demand. Passengers can expect a meal service on most carriers.

This is a domestic route within United States. Both airports operate in the same country, which may simplify travel requirements and documentation.

Time zone information: When it's 06:53 in Houston, it's 06:53 in Mitchell.

There is a significant elevation difference of 1,209 feet between the two airports. Mitchell Municipal Airport sits higher than George Bush Intcntl/Houston Airport.

The return flight from Mitchell (MHE) to Houston (IAH) follows a heading of 170° (south).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
